Pulse Volume up 9% And Other Digital Transactions News briefs from 4/20/23

  • Discover Network reported $54.1 billion in Discover Card volume for the first quarter, up 9.5% over the same period last year. Discover’s Pulse debit network processed $65.3 billion in volume, a 9% increase year-over-year. Revenue net of interest expense rose 29% to $3.75 billion, but net income dropped 21% year-over-year owing largely to a $948-million increase in the company’s provision for credit losses.
  • Aurora Payments LLC said it acquired NailSoft, a salon management and point-of-sale system. Terms were not disclosed.
  • E-commerce services provider Wix.com Ltd. said it extended its integration with Square that now allows restaurant owners to sync their Wix Restaurants site with their Square accounts to expedite online ordering.
  • E-commerce checkout provider Cart.com selected Nuvei Corp. as its exclusive payments partner, Nuvei said.
  • U.S. Bank and Elavon said they are the new payment partners of the California Restaurant Association, which counts 22,000 member locations.
  • Payments provider Payoneer said it will offer its services to merchants using the accounting platform Zoho Books.
  • Accounting services provider Lockstep said its Lockstep Self-Service component now enables users to accept online payments from their customers using Stripe, PayPal, or the merchant processor of their choice.
  • Cryptocurrency advocacy group the Digital Currency Monetary Authority released a white paper on Unicoin, an international central bank digital currency.
